Overview
- Multiple outlets report the Galaxy S25 FE is powered by Samsung’s Exynos 2400 processor paired with 8GB of RAM and available in 128GB or 256GB storage configurations.
- The S25 FE features a 6.7-inch Dynamic AMOLED 2X display with a 120Hz refresh rate, Gorilla Glass Victus protection and an IP68-rated, 7.4 mm-thin, 190 g chassis.
- Samsung has reduced the S25 FE’s battery to 4,500 mAh to achieve a slimmer profile while increasing charging speeds to 45W wired and 15W wireless, and it will ship with Android 16 and One UI 8.
- Leaked Galaxy A17 promo materials confirm it runs on the Exynos 1330 chipset in a 7.5 mm, 192 g body and sports a 6.7-inch Super AMOLED display at 90Hz with Corning Gorilla Glass Victus.
- The A17’s camera array gains optical image stabilization on its 50 MP main sensor alongside a 5 MP ultrawide and 2 MP macro lens, and it packs a 5,000 mAh battery with 25W charging (charger included in key markets) while launching on Android 15 with One UI 7 and six years of promised updates.
